Hermie Sadler To Return To The Track at Bristol Motor Speedway
Press Release(August 12, 2009) - Hermie Sadler, the 1993 Nationwide Series Rookie of the Year and current analyst for SPEED, will pilot Andy Hillenburg’s #48 in the O’Reilly 200 NASCAR Camping World Truck Series race at Bristol Motor Speedway.
The truck will carry the colors of Victory Junction and The Hermie and Elliott Sadler Foundation to create awareness courtesy of Joe Denette, a Spotsylvania, Virginia native who won the Mega Millions Lottery jackpot back in May of this year. Denette will make a $100,000.00 contribution to both charities during Bristol race weekend.
“I really appreciate what The Sadler Family and the Petty family do for so many kids that need their help,” stated Joe Denette. “ I am now fortunate to be in a position to make a difference, and I encourage other people to do the same. I am looking forward to seeing Hermie back on the track while creating awareness for both these fine charities.”
Sadler, who has not raced since Martinsville this spring, is looking forward to getting back on the track at Bristol. “ I miss being behind the wheel”, stated Sadler. “This gives me a chance to go have a little fun on a Wednesday night while creating awareness for our foundation and Victory Junction.
Kyle Petty will receive the donation from Denette on behalf of Victory Junction. “What Joe is doing will have an incredible impact on a lot of kids at camp,” stated Petty. “We are honored to be a part of Hermie’s return to the track and we appreciate all the great things Hermie and Elliott do for Autism through their foundation.”
The O’Reilly 200 is live on SPEED beginning at 8 pm eastern on August 19.
